Learning

Ascending Vs Descending Order

Ascending Vs Descending Order
Ascending Vs Descending Order

Understanding the concepts of Ascending Vs Descending Order is fundamental in various fields, including mathematics, computer science, and data analysis. These ordering methods are essential for organizing data efficiently and performing accurate analyses. This post will delve into the definitions, applications, and differences between ascending and descending order, providing a comprehensive guide for anyone looking to master these concepts.

Understanding Ascending Order

Ascending order refers to the arrangement of elements from the smallest to the largest. This method is widely used in sorting algorithms, database queries, and statistical analyses. When data is sorted in ascending order, it becomes easier to identify patterns, trends, and outliers.

For example, consider a list of numbers: 5, 3, 8, 1, 4. When sorted in ascending order, the list becomes: 1, 3, 4, 5, 8. This arrangement allows for quick identification of the smallest and largest values, as well as any intermediate values.

Understanding Descending Order

Descending order, on the other hand, involves arranging elements from the largest to the smallest. This method is useful in scenarios where the focus is on identifying the highest values or prioritizing elements based on their magnitude. For instance, in financial analysis, descending order can help in identifying the top-performing stocks or the highest expenses.

Using the same list of numbers: 5, 3, 8, 1, 4, when sorted in descending order, the list becomes: 8, 5, 4, 3, 1. This arrangement highlights the largest value first, making it easier to spot the most significant elements.

Applications of Ascending Vs Descending Order

Both ascending and descending order have numerous applications across various fields. Here are some key areas where these ordering methods are commonly used:

  • Mathematics: In mathematics, sorting numbers in ascending or descending order is a basic operation that helps in solving problems related to statistics, algebra, and calculus.
  • Computer Science: In computer science, sorting algorithms are essential for organizing data efficiently. Algorithms like bubble sort, quicksort, and merge sort use ascending and descending order to arrange data.
  • Data Analysis: In data analysis, sorting data in ascending or descending order helps in identifying trends, patterns, and outliers. This is crucial for making informed decisions based on data.
  • Database Management: In database management, queries often involve sorting data in ascending or descending order to retrieve information efficiently.

Differences Between Ascending Vs Descending Order

While both ascending and descending order are used for sorting data, there are key differences between the two:

  • Direction of Sorting: Ascending order sorts data from the smallest to the largest, while descending order sorts data from the largest to the smallest.
  • Use Cases: Ascending order is often used when the focus is on identifying the smallest values or arranging data in a sequential manner. Descending order is used when the focus is on identifying the largest values or prioritizing elements based on their magnitude.
  • Visual Representation: In visual representations, ascending order is typically represented from left to right or top to bottom, while descending order is represented from right to left or bottom to top.

Here is a simple comparison table to illustrate the differences:

Aspect Ascending Order Descending Order
Direction Smallest to Largest Largest to Smallest
Use Cases Identifying smallest values, sequential arrangement Identifying largest values, prioritization
Visual Representation Left to Right, Top to Bottom Right to Left, Bottom to Top

Sorting Algorithms and Ascending Vs Descending Order

Sorting algorithms play a crucial role in organizing data in ascending or descending order. Some of the most commonly used sorting algorithms include:

  • Bubble Sort: A simple sorting algorithm that repeatedly steps through the list, compares adjacent elements, and swaps them if they are in the wrong order. This process is repeated until the list is sorted.
  • Quick Sort: A highly efficient sorting algorithm that uses a divide-and-conquer approach. It selects a 'pivot' element and partitions the other elements into two sub-arrays, according to whether they are less than or greater than the pivot. The sub-arrays are then sorted recursively.
  • Merge Sort: A divide-and-conquer algorithm that divides the unsorted list into n sublists, each containing one element (a list of one element is considered sorted), and repeatedly merges sublists to produce newly sorted sublists until there is only one sublist remaining. This will be the sorted list.

These algorithms can be modified to sort data in either ascending or descending order by adjusting the comparison logic. For example, in bubble sort, if the algorithm swaps elements when the first is greater than the second, the data will be sorted in ascending order. Conversely, if the algorithm swaps elements when the first is less than the second, the data will be sorted in descending order.

💡 Note: The choice of sorting algorithm depends on the specific requirements of the task, such as the size of the data set, the need for stability, and the available computational resources.

Real-World Examples of Ascending Vs Descending Order

To better understand the practical applications of ascending and descending order, let's consider some real-world examples:

  • Student Grades: In educational settings, student grades are often sorted in descending order to identify the top performers. This helps in recognizing academic achievements and providing appropriate rewards or recognition.
  • Financial Transactions: In financial analysis, transactions are often sorted in descending order to identify the largest expenses or revenues. This helps in budgeting, financial planning, and identifying areas for cost reduction.
  • Inventory Management: In inventory management, items are often sorted in ascending order based on their quantity to identify which items are running low and need to be restocked. This helps in maintaining optimal inventory levels and avoiding stockouts.

These examples illustrate how ascending and descending order can be applied in various scenarios to enhance efficiency, accuracy, and decision-making.

Here is an image that visually represents the concept of ascending and descending order:

Ascending and Descending Order

Conclusion

Understanding the concepts of Ascending Vs Descending Order is essential for organizing data efficiently and performing accurate analyses. Whether in mathematics, computer science, data analysis, or database management, these ordering methods play a crucial role in various applications. By mastering the differences and applications of ascending and descending order, individuals can enhance their problem-solving skills and make informed decisions based on data. The choice between ascending and descending order depends on the specific requirements of the task, and selecting the appropriate sorting algorithm can further optimize the process.

Related Terms:

  • ascending vs descending order numbers
  • ascending vs descending order letters
  • ascending and descending order example
  • ascending vs descending order alphabet
  • ascending vs descending meaning
  • ascending vs descending order time
Facebook Twitter WhatsApp
Related Posts
Don't Miss